Назад в блог
5 мин чтения

Past Simple vs Present Perfect: в чём разница и как их не путать

В чем разница между Past Simple и Present Perfect? Объясняем на простых примерах с правилами. Поймете раз и навсегда!

difference between the present perfect and past simple tensepast simple vs present perfectEnglish grammarverb tenseswhen to use present perfect

Главное различие между временами Past Simple и Present Perfect заключается в их связи с настоящим моментом. Past Simple используется для действий, которые завершились в определенный, закончившийся момент в прошлом, в то время как Present Perfect — для действий, которые имеют связь с настоящим, например, произошли в еще не закончившемся периоде времени или имеют результат в настоящем.

Для многих изучающих английский язык освоение времен глаголов похоже на взлом секретного кода. Одной из самых запутанных пар являются Past Simple и Present Perfect. Оба времени говорят о прошлом, так в чем же дело? Понимание тонкого, но решающего различия между Present Perfect и Past Simple — ключ к тому, чтобы звучать более естественно и точно. В этом руководстве мы разберем все на понятных правилах и примерах.

В каких случаях используется Past Simple?

Время Past Simple — ваш основной выбор для действий, событий или состояний, которые начались и закончились в прошлом. Самое важное правило — время действия *завершено* и часто *указано*. Представьте это как событие за закрытой дверью: оно произошло, оно закончилось, и мы пошли дальше.

Ищите слова-маркеры, указывающие на конкретное время:

  • yesterday (вчера)
  • last week/month/year (на прошлой неделе/в прошлом месяце/году)
  • five minutes ago (пять минут назад)
  • in 2015 (в 2015 году)
  • when I was a child (когда я был ребенком)

Примеры:

  • I visited my grandmother last weekend. (Я навестил свою бабушку на прошлых выходных. Выходные закончились).
  • She graduated from university in 2020. (Она окончила университет в 2020 году. 2020 год закончился).
  • They ate pizza for dinner yesterday. (Они ели пиццу на ужин вчера. Вчера — это закончившийся период времени).

В каждом случае действие прочно закреплено в прошлом в определенный момент.

Чем Present Perfect отличается от Past Simple на практике?

В то время как Past Simple смотрит на завершенное событие в прошлом, Present Perfect всегда держит одну ногу в настоящем. Он строит мост из прошлого в «сейчас». Давайте рассмотрим три основных случая его использования.

Как использовать Present Perfect для действий в незаконченном периоде времени?

Если временной период, о котором вы говорите, все еще продолжается, вам нужен Present Perfect. Действие произошло в прошлом, но период, в котором оно произошло, еще не закончился.

Распространенные слова-маркеры незаконченного времени:

  • today (сегодня)
  • this week/month/year (на этой неделе/в этом месяце/году)
  • so far (до сих пор, на данный момент)
  • in my life (в моей жизни)

Примеры:

  • She has called me three times *today*. (Она звонила мне три раза *сегодня*. Сегодня еще не закончилось, она может позвонить снова).
  • We have sold fifty tickets *this week*. (Мы продали пятьдесят билетов *на этой неделе*. Неделя еще не закончилась).
  • Сравните с Past Simple: I drank a lot of coffee *yesterday*. (Я пил много кофе *вчера*. Вчера полностью закончилось).

Почему Present Perfect используют, когда важен результат в настоящем?

Иногда конкретное время совершения действия не имеет значения. Важен результат, который мы можем видеть или чувствовать *сейчас*. Present Perfect идеально для этого подходит.

Примеры:

  • "I've lost my keys." (Прошлое действие — потеря ключей. Результат в настоящем — я не могу попасть домой).
  • "He has broken his arm." (Прошлое действие — несчастный случай. Результат в настоящем — его рука в гипсе).
  • "They've just arrived." (Прошлое действие — их прибытие. Результат в настоящем — они здесь).

Использование Past Simple, "I lost my keys", могло бы означать, что вы потеряли их в прошлом году и с тех пор нашли или купили новые. Present Perfect подчеркивает немедленное последствие.

Зачем нужно Present Perfect, чтобы говорить о жизненном опыте?

Когда мы говорим об общем жизненном опыте, мы используем Present Perfect. Это относится к действию, которое произошло в какой-то неопределенный момент в жизни человека до настоящего времени. Точная дата не важна, важен сам опыт.

Здесь часто встречаются слова-маркеры ever (когда-либо), never (никогда), и before (раньше).

Примеры:

  • "Have you ever been to Mexico?" (Вы когда-нибудь были в Мексике? Я спрашиваю о всем вашем жизненном опыте до текущего момента).
  • "My brother has never seen snow." (Мой брат никогда не видел снега. За всю свою жизнь этого не случалось).
  • "I think I've seen this film before." (Мне кажется, я видел этот фильм раньше. В какой-то момент в моем прошлом этот опыт произошел).

Если бы вы добавили конкретное время, вы бы переключились на Past Simple: "I went to Mexico in 2018." (Я ездил в Мексику в 2018 году).

Как запомнить ключевую разницу между Present Perfect и Past Simple?

Чувствуете, что запутались? Не стоит. Используйте этот краткий чек-лист, чтобы решить, какое время использовать. Спросите себя: есть ли сильная связь с настоящим?

  • Используйте Past Simple, когда:
  • Действие на 100% завершено.
  • Время указано и тоже завершено (например, last night, in 1999, two days ago).
  • Нет прямого результата в настоящем.
  • Используйте Present Perfect, когда:
  • Период времени *незавершен* (например, today, this month).
  • Время не упоминается, но *результат* важен сейчас (например, "I've cut my finger!" — Я порезал палец!).
  • Вы говорите об общем *жизненном опыте* (например, "She has traveled a lot." — Она много путешествовала).

В заключение, освоение разницы между present perfect и past simple сводится к контексту и точке зрения. Past Simple — это как фотография прошлого события, полная и завершенная. Present Perfect — это линия, соединяющая прошлое событие с текущей реальностью. С практикой выбор правильного времени станет для вас второй натурой.


Часто задаваемые вопросы (FAQ)

Вопрос 1: Можно ли использовать Present Perfect со словом 'yesterday'? Нет, нельзя. 'Yesterday' (вчера) — это завершенный период времени. Поэтому вы должны использовать Past Simple. Например, говорите "I saw him yesterday", а не "I have seen him yesterday."

Вопрос 2: Какая разница между "I lost my keys" и "I've lost my keys"? "I lost my keys" (Past Simple) — это простое утверждение о прошлом событии; возможно, вы нашли их позже. "I've lost my keys" (Present Perfect) подчеркивает результат в настоящем: я не могу открыть дверь *прямо сейчас*.

Вопрос 3: Как правильно: 'I have finished' или 'I finished'? Оба варианта могут быть правильными в зависимости от контекста. Если начальник просит отчитаться о задаче, вы можете сказать: "I have finished the report", чтобы показать результат (отчет готов). Если друг спрашивает, что вы делали утром, вы можете ответить: "I finished the report at 11 am", указав конкретное время в прошлом.

Вопрос 4: Почему о жизненном опыте говорят в Present Perfect? Потому что ваша жизнь — это незаконченный период времени. Когда вы говорите "I have been to Italy" (Я был в Италии), вы говорите об опыте в рамках периода 'моя жизнь до сих пор'. Если человек уже умер, вы переключитесь на Past Simple: "Leonardo da Vinci painted the Mona Lisa." (Леонардо да Винчи нарисовал Мону Лизу).

Вопрос 5: Есть ли разница в употреблении этих времен в американском и британском английском? Да, есть небольшое различие. В британском английском Present Perfect чаще используется для недавних событий, особенно со словами just, already, и yet. В американском английском в этих ситуациях часто можно услышать Past Simple, например: "Did you eat yet?" (AmE) вместо "Have you eaten yet?" (BrE).